    Broadband Fiber Optic GPON Fiber Optic Equipment

    GPON called a Gigabit Passive Optical Network, is a point-to-multipoint fiber access network that delivers service to multiple users via fiber optic cable. GPON network consists of an OLT (Optical Line Terminal), ONT (Optical Network Terminal, or ONU, Optical Network Unit), and.     Fiber optic cable bending degree in computer room equipment

    Always keep the fiber optic cable bend radius at least 20 times the cable diameter during installation and 10 times after installation to prevent damage and signal loss. Proper bend radius control ensures the integrity of optical performance and protects the glass.
